2.  Introduction

   This memo defines a portion of the Management Information Base (MIB)
   for use with network management protocols in the Internet community.
   It is becoming increasingly important to support Dynamic
   Authorization extensions on the network access server (NAS) devices
   to handle the Disconnect and Change-of-Authorization (CoA) messages
   as described in [RFC3576] .  As a result, the effective management of
   RADIUS Dynamic Authorization entities is of considerable importance.
   It complements the managed objects used for managing RADIUS
   authentication and accounting clients as described in [RFC2618] and
   [RFC2620], respectively.

4.  Terminology

   Dynamic Authorization Server (DAS)

   The component that resides on the NAS which processes the Disconnect
   and CoA requests sent by the Dynamic Authorization Client as
   described in [RFC3576].

   Dynamic Authorization Client (DAC)

   The component which sends the Disconnect and CoA requests to the
   Dynamic Authorization Server as described in [RFC3576].  This is
   typically a RADIUS Server, but is not limited to it and may, for
   example, be a Rating Engine used for Prepaid Billing.

   Dynamic Authorization Server Port

   The UDP port on which the Dynamic Authorization server listens for
   the Disconnect and CoA requests sent by the Dynamic Authorization
   Client.

5.  Overview

   The RADIUS dynamic authorization extensions defined in [RFC3576],
   distinguish between the client function and the server function.  In
   RADIUS dynamic authorization, clients send Disconnect-Requests and
   CoA-Requests, and servers reply with Disconnect-Acks, CoA-Acks, and
   CoA-NAKs.  Typically NAS devices implement the DAS function, and thus
   would be expected to implement the RADIUS dynamic authorization
   server MIB, while DACs implement the client function, and thus would
   be expected to implement the RADIUS dynamic authorization client MIB.

   However, it is possible for a RADIUS dynamic authorization entity to
   perform both client and server functions.  For example, a RADIUS
   proxy may act as a DAS to one or more DACs, while simultaneously
   acting as a DAC to one or more DASs.  In such situations, it is
   expected that RADIUS entities combining client and server
   functionality will support both the client and server MIBs.

   This memo describes the MIB for dynamic authorization servers and
   relates to the following documents as follows:

   [RFC2618] describes the MIB for a RADIUS authentication client.

   [RFC2619] describes the MIB for a RADIUS authentication server.

   [RFC2620] describes the MIB for a RADIUS accounting client.

   [RFC2621] describes the MIB for a RADIUS accounting server.

   [DYNCLNT] describes the MIB for a RADIUS dynamic authorization
   client.

   A NAS typically implements the MIBs for a RADIUS authentication
   client, a RADIUS accounting client, and a RADIUS dynamic
   authorization server.  However, there is not strict relationship
   between these three MIBs, i.e. one MIB can be implemented without
   implementing the other MIBs.  Similarly, for the other 3 MIBs
   mentioned above, a typical case would be where the MIBs for a RADIUS
   authentication server, a RADIUS accounting server, and a RADIUS
   dynamic authorization client are implemented by the same device.
   However, also for these 3 MIBs, they can be implemented independent
   from each other.  A RADIUS proxy might implement any of these 6 MIBs,
   but can also implement any subset of these MIBs.

7.  Security Considerations

   There are no management objects defined in this MIB module that have
   a MAX-ACCESS clause of read-write and/or read-create.  So, if this
   MIB module is implemented correctly, then there is no risk that an
   intruder can alter or create any management objects of this MIB
   module via direct SNMP SET operations

   Some of the readable objects in this MIB module (i.e., objects with a
   MAX-ACCESS other than not-accessible) may be considered sensitive or
   vulnerable in some network environments.  It is thus important to
   control even GET and/or NOTIFY access to these objects and possibly
   to even encrypt the values of these objects when sending them over
   the network via SNMP.  These are the tables and objects and their
   sensitivity/vulnerability:

   radiusDynAuthClientAddress and radiusDynAuthClientAddressType

   These can be used to determine the address of the DAC with which the
   DAS is communicating.  This information could be useful in mounting
   an attack on the DAC.

   radiusDynAuthServerIdentifier

   This can be used to determine the Identifier of the DAS.  This
   information could be useful in impersonating the DAS.

   SNMP versions prior to SNMPv3 did not include adequate security.
   Even if the network itself is secure (for example by using IPSec),
   even then, there is no control as to who on the secure network is
   allowed to access and GET/SET (read/change/create/delete) the objects
   in this MIB module.

   It is RECOMMENDED that implementers consider the security features as
   provided by the SNMPv3 framework (see [RFC3410], section 8),
   including full support for the SNMPv3 cryptographic mechanisms (for
   authentication and privacy).

   Further, deployment of SNMP versions prior to SNMPv3 is NOT
   RECOMMENDED.  Instead, it is RECOMMENDED to deploy SNMPv3 and to
   enable cryptographic security.  It is then a customer/operator
   responsibility to ensure that the SNMP entity giving access to an
   instance of this MIB module is properly configured to give access to
   the objects only to those principals (users) that have legitimate
   rights to indeed GET or SET (change/create/delete) them.
